Railway loading space of oil depots is a special place for arriving and delivering combustible oil, and coordinates crude oil processing, product oil supplying and transporting. Once an accident happened in railway loading space of oil depots, the results will be serious. With the development of petrochemical industry, the safety assessment for the railway loading system of oil depots has already become indispensible to safety in production and safety management of oil depots. And choosing assessment methods which is the key of the work, influences the assessment results directly, furthermore, has significant meanings to improve the quality of the safety assessments for railway loading space of oil depots and ensure safety in production.In this paper, firstly, introduced common assessment methods systematically, concluded all the characteristics of themselves and their limitations in applications. Meanwhile, introduced a new machine learning method named SVM (Support Vector Machines), and fully dissertated the advantages of SVM in safety assessment by comparing with other traditional methods.Secondly, on the basis of principles of scientific, systemic, maneuverability, quantitative etc, in the sight of"Human-Machine-Environment-Management", fully considered the characteristics that there are more nonlinear factors influence the loading system of oil depots for safety in production, then, established the index system of safety assessment for railway loading system of oil depots , in which showed many important factors in the safe production process of the railway loading system of oil depots.Finally, combined the index system which had been established with the data that was collected from the oil depots affiliated with Jilin Branched of PetroChina Company Limited, built up a Least Square Support Vector Machine (LSSVM) model for safety assessment which is suited to assess the railway loading system of oil depots, then, completed the model training and test with MATLAB by its powerful computing and visualization functions.Guided by the theory of safety system engineering, applied LSSVM in system safety analysis and assessment, which can provide more effective ways and methods for safety management and scientific decision-making in railway loading system of oil depots and scientific, rational, qualitative and quantitative safety assessment in safety assessment agencies.
